About the role
As a Manufacturing Leader, you will be responsible for leading and developing the manufacturing team, ensuring safe, efficient, and high quality operations. This role plays a key part in driving continuous improvement, cost reduction initiatives, and process excellence while supporting new product introduction and sustaining existing manufacturing processes.
Your leadership will directly impact productivity, quality, cost competitiveness, and operational stability within the plant.
Key Responsibilities
- As a Manufacturing Leader, you’ll be responsible for:
- Leading and coordinating the manufacturing team to execute critical activities related to production, maintenance, quality, EHS, and training.
- Driving continuous improvement and cost reduction strategies to increase productivity, reduce waste, and mitigate quality risks.
- Ensuring manufacturing team participation in PMO, Passport, and PCR activities for the evaluation of new products, concepts, designs, prototypes, and testing.
- Managing and tracking activities and budget related to maintenance, process improvements, and manufacturing equipment.
- Ensuring process standards, procedures, and specifications are documented, published, and kept up to date.
- Ensuring compliance with Carrier Excellence, Quality Management Systems (ISO), and EHS requirements.
- Managing and controlling the department budget.
- Managing tooling and manufacturing resources to support efficient and stable operations.
- Supporting structured problem solving activities and cross functional collaboration.
Requirements
We are looking for hands on, results driven leaders with strong technical and people management skills who thrive in manufacturing environments.
As a minimum you must have:
-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Mechanical Administrative Engineering, Mechatronics Engineering, or a related field.
- Approximately 5 years of experience across manufacturing operations, project execution, budget management, and maintenance activities within industrial environments.
- Strong experience in manufacturing processes and continuous improvement.
- Experience managing personnel (3 direct reports: 2 technicians and 1 engineer).
- Solid knowledge of G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ning & Tolerancing).
- Advanced English proficiency (written and verbal)
- Problem solving and root cause analysis.
- Lean Manufacturing.
- Quality assurance and process control.
- Manufacturing process development and sustainment.
- Continuous improvement tools and methodologies.
Technical Focus Area
o High Frequency Induction Welding (HFIW).
o Induction welding of aluminum tubing.
o Engineering friendly processes focused on process improvement, standardization, and sustainment.
Although not necessary, it would be nice if you have:
- Experience with Core Tools (PF, PFMEA, Control Plan, MC).
- Experience supporting new product introduction (NPI).
